It's put in my dedicated place for this project so i don't litter this list more than necessary. http://abcnc.se/projects/storebro260.html Ok, then, a few points: The main problem right now is to establish a reliable part-reference point and make it running in a non-singlestepping mode. It would also be nice if the Shift-key worked ! There is a funny thing about the shiftkey: In some versions of FANUC6 /Sinumerik 6T it looks like the shiftkey is absent. In my machine the key is present but the functionality is absent! The manual is lousy too, it's a Sinumerik version translated to Swedish with almost no code examples.
